Overslaan naar inhoud

Slimmer inkopen: laat Odoo bepalen wat en wanneer

Hoe Odoo Purchase het inkoopproces automatiseert — van offerteaanvraag tot leveranciersvergelijking en driewegmatching.
7 mei 2026 in
Slimmer inkopen: laat Odoo bepalen wat en wanneer
Daniel

Deze blogserie

  • Deel 1 — Wat levert Odoo AI op? Zes praktijkvoorbeelden
  • Deel 2 — Nooit meer te veel of te weinig op voorraad: AI in Odoo Inventory
  • Deel 3 — Slimmer inkopen: laat Odoo bepalen wat en wanneer
  • Deel 4 — Facturen die zichzelf verwerken: AI in Odoo Accounting
  • Deel 5 — Van lead tot deal zonder handmatig klikken: AI in Odoo CRM & Sales
  • Deel 6 — Sneller en slimmer klantenservice verlenen: AI in Odoo Helpdesk

In de vorige post ging het over hoe Odoo Inventory bijhoudt wat er op voorraad is en wanneer er aangevuld moet worden. Die post eindigde waar dit inkoop-verhaal begint: het moment dat het systeem besluit dat er besteld moet worden.

Want aanvullen is één ding. Maar bij wie bestel je? Voor welke prijs? Hoe vergelijk je twee leveranciers? En hoe weet je zeker dat je niet meer betaalt dan wat er geleverd is?

Dit zijn vragen die in veel MKB-bedrijven nog handmatig worden beantwoord: een mail naar de vaste leverancier, een prijsopgave afwachten, en dan maar hopen dat de factuur klopt met wat er is binnengekomen. Odoo Purchase legt hier een gestructureerd en grotendeels geautomatiseerd proces overheen — dat ook nog eens volledig is geïntegreerd met voorraad en boekhouding.

Het inkoopproces in Odoo: van behoefte tot betaalde factuur

Odoo beschrijft het inkoopproces als een aaneenschakeling van vier stappen die automatisch op elkaar volgen: de offerteaanvraag (RFQ), de inkooporder (PO), de ontvangst in het magazijn, en de leveranciersfactuur. Elke stap genereert automatisch de volgende — je hoeft niet handmatig te kopiëren of over te typen.

1. Automatische offerteaanvragen

Zoals beschreven in de vorige post, kunnen aanvulregels in Odoo automatisch een inkooporder of offerteaanvraag aanmaken zodra de verwachte voorraad onder een drempel daalt. De offerteaanvraag wordt al gevuld met de juiste leverancier, het product, de hoeveelheid en de prijs — op basis van de gegevens die je per product hebt ingevoerd. Je hoeft hem alleen nog te versturen of goed te keuren.


Hoe dat eruitziet

Je hebt product X bij leverancier A staan met een vaste prijs en een minimale bestelhoeveelheid. Zodra de aanvulregel triggert, staat er 's ochtends een conceptaanvraag klaar: leverancier ingevuld, prijs ingevuld, hoeveelheid berekend op basis van het maximumvoorraadniveau. Jij klikt op Versturen. De leverancier ontvangt een professionele PDF per mail. Alles is in twee minuten geregeld.

Beschikbaar vanaf Odoo 17 · Odoo Purchase → Bestellingen → Offerteaanvragen

2. Meerdere leveranciers vergelijken met één klik

Wil je niet automatisch bij de vaste leverancier bestellen maar eerst prijzen vergelijken? Dan gebruik je de offerteaanvraag naar meerdere leveranciers — in de Odoo-documentatie ook wel "call for tenders" of alternatieve offertes genoemd. Je maakt één offerteaanvraag aan en dupliceert die naar twee of drie andere leveranciers. Wanneer de reacties binnenkomen, vergelijkt Odoo ze naast elkaar: prijs, levertijd, minimale bestelhoeveelheid. Je selecteert de winnaar, Odoo zet die om naar een inkooporder en annuleert de rest automatisch.


Hoe dat eruitziet

Je vraagt prijzen op bij drie leveranciers voor een grote bestelling verpakkingsmateriaal. Binnen twee dagen zijn alle reacties binnen. Je opent het vergelijkingsscherm: leverancier B is goedkoper per stuk, maar leverancier C levert vijf dagen eerder. Op basis van je huidige voorraadsituatie kies je voor C. Met één klik wordt de offerteaanvraag bij C omgezet naar een bevestigde inkooporder. De andere twee worden automatisch geannuleerd.

Beschikbaar vanaf Odoo 17 · Vereist activatie van Inkoopovereenkomsten in de instellingen

3. Ontvangst en driewegmatching

Zodra een inkooporder is bevestigd, maakt Odoo automatisch een ontvangstdocument aan in de voorraadmodule. Wanneer de goederen binnenkomen, valideer je de ontvangst. Odoo vergelijkt dan automatisch drie documenten: de inkooporder (wat besteld is), de ontvangst (wat er daadwerkelijk binnengekomen is), en de leveranciersfactuur (wat er gefactureerd wordt). Dit heet driewegmatching.

Als er afwijkingen zijn — meer gefactureerd dan ontvangen, of een andere prijs dan afgesproken — signaleert Odoo dat direct. Je betaalt nooit stilzwijgend meer dan wat je hebt ontvangen.


Hoe dat eruitziet

Je bestelt 500 dozen bij leverancier A. Er komen er 480 binnen — de rest volgt later. Je valideert de ontvangst voor 480 dozen. Odoo maakt automatisch een nalevering aan voor de resterende 20. De leveranciersfactuur die binnenkomt voor 500 dozen wordt geblokkeerd: Odoo ziet dat er slechts 480 ontvangen zijn en geeft een waarschuwing. Je betaalt pas de volledige factuur nadat de nalevering is binnengekomen en gevalideerd.

Beschikbaar vanaf Odoo 17 · Stel factureringsbeleid in op "ontvangen hoeveelheden"

Je leveranciers leren kennen via data

Naast het automatiseren van het bestelproces bouwt Odoo Purchase over tijd een waardevol overzicht op van hoe je leveranciers presteren. Via het inkooprapport zie je per leverancier: hoeveel je hebt besteld, tegen welke prijs, hoe vaak de levertijd is gehaald, en hoe zich dat verhoudt tot afgesproken doorlooptijden.

Die data is waardevol bij leveranciersonderhandelingen. Als je kunt laten zien dat een leverancier de afgelopen zes maanden gemiddeld drie dagen later heeft geleverd dan afgesproken, heb je een stevige basis voor een gesprek over kortingen of betere leverafspraken.


Hoe dat eruitziet

Je bereidt een jaarlijks leveranciersoverleg voor. In plaats van met een gevoel de kamer in te lopen, open je het inkooprapport in Odoo. Je exporteert een overzicht van alle bestellingen van de afgelopen twaalf maanden: totale bestede waarde, gemiddelde levertijd versus afgesproken levertijd, en prijsontwikkeling per product. Het gesprek gaat over feiten in plaats van indrukken.

Beschikbaar vanaf Odoo 17 · Odoo Purchase → Rapportage → Inkoopanalyse

Wat het concreet oplevert

Minder handmatig werk. Van aanvulregel tot verstuurde offerteaanvraag in twee minuten. Van bevestigde inkooporder tot ontvangstdocument zonder extra handelingen. Elke stap die Odoo automatisch zet, is een stap die een medewerker niet handmatig hoeft te doen.

Minder fouten bij facturering. Driewegmatching voorkomt dat je meer betaalt dan je hebt ontvangen. Voor bedrijven met een hoog inkoopvolume is dit direct relevant: één onjuiste factuur die onopgemerkt wordt goedgekeurd kost meer dan de investering in een goed ingericht systeem.

Betere leveranciersrelaties. Niet omdat het systeem vriendelijker communiceert, maar omdat je gesprekken kunt voeren op basis van data in plaats van gevoel. Dat levert scherpere prijzen en betere afspraken op.


Samenhang met Odoo Inventory

Odoo Purchase en Inventory zijn nauw met elkaar verbonden. Een bevestigde inkooporder maakt automatisch een ontvangst aan in Inventory. Een aanvulregel in Inventory triggert automatisch een offerteaanvraag in Purchase. Je hoeft dit niet handmatig te koppelen — het werkt zo uit de doos, mits beide modules actief zijn.


Wanneer werkt het, en wanneer niet?

Odoo Purchase werkt het best als je productgegevens, leveranciersinformatie en prijzen correct zijn ingericht. De automatische offerteaanvraag is zo goed als de data die eraan ten grondslag ligt: klopt de vaste prijs bij leverancier A nog? Is de minimale bestelhoeveelheid bijgewerkt na de laatste prijsafspraak?


Let op

De driewegmatching werkt alleen correct als het factureringsbeleid per product is ingesteld op "ontvangen hoeveelheden" in plaats van "bestelde hoeveelheden". Bij de tweede instelling wordt de factuur direct bij bestelling vrijgegeven — ook als de goederen nog niet zijn binnengekomen. Dit is een configuratiekeuze die bij de inrichting aandacht verdient.

Ook is het goed om te beseffen dat automatisering van inkooporders het beste werkt voor producten met een stabiel en voorspelbaar bestelpatroon. Voor incidentele inkoop van niet-standaard materialen of diensten blijft handmatige beoordeling de betere keuze.

Wat je nodig hebt om te beginnen

De kern van Odoo Purchase — offerteaanvragen, inkooporders, ontvangsten en driewegmatching — is beschikbaar voor alle Odoo-gebruikers met de Purchase-module actief. Geen extra AI-configuratie vereist voor de basisfunctionaliteit.

Voor de vergelijking van alternatieve offertes (call for tenders) moet je Inkoopovereenkomsten activeren in de Purchase-instellingen. Dat is een instelling van dertig seconden, maar een die veel bedrijven nooit hebben gevonden.

De grootste investering zit ook hier in de inrichting: productgegevens op orde, leveranciersinformatie compleet, factureringsbeleid correct ingesteld, en aanvulregels die aansluiten op de werkelijke bestelpatronen. Dat vraagt kennis van je inkoopprocessen én van hoe Odoo die processen vertaalt. Een onafhankelijke Odoo-consultant helpt je die vertaalslag te maken zonder dat je zelf hoeft uit te zoeken waar alle instellingen zitten.


Over KoTeJa

Als onafhankelijk Odoo-consultant help ik MKB-bedrijven het inkoopproces in Odoo zo in te richten dat automatisering daadwerkelijk werkt — van aanvulregel tot betaalde factuur. Neem gerust contact op.


Conclusie

Odoo Purchase is geen losstaand systeem maar een verlengstuk van Inventory en Accounting. Samen vormen de drie modules een gesloten keten: de voorraad signaleert een tekort, Purchase zet een bestelling klaar, de ontvangst wordt geregistreerd, en de factuur wordt automatisch gecontroleerd op wat er werkelijk geleverd is.

Het resultaat is een inkoopproces dat minder handmatig werk kost, minder fouten oplevert en meer inzicht geeft in hoe je leveranciers presteren. Niet als belofte, maar als uitkomst van een goed ingericht systeem.

In de volgende post ga ik in op Odoo Accounting: hoe factuurverwerking via OCR werkt, wat bankreconciliatie met AI oplevert, en wanneer de investering in een goede boekhoudinginrichting zichzelf terugverdient.

Daniel van Baalen  ·  KoTeJa  ·  Meer over Odoo AI →       ·       Alle blogposts →

Nooit meer te veel of te weinig op voorraad
Hoe AI in Odoo Inventory voorraadtekorten en overstock voorkomt — zonder dat je er continu zelf achteraan hoeft te zitten.